GOP voter registration fraud case leads to arrest
Mark Jacoby, who was arrested in Ontario and owns a firm hired by the
California Republican Party, violated state registration laws,
authorities say.
By Evan Halper
Los Angeles Times Staff Writer

2:38 PM PDT, October 19, 2008

SACRAMENTO — The owner of a firm that the California Republican Party
hired to register tens of thousands of voters this year was arrested
in Ontario late last night on suspicion of voter registration fraud.

State and local investigators allege that Mark Jacoby fraudulently
registered himself to vote at a childhood California address where he
no longer lives so he would appear to meet the legal requirement that
signature gatherers be eligible to vote in California.

Jacoby's arrest by state investigators and the Ontario Police
Department comes after dozens of voters said they were duped into
registering as Republicans by his firm, Young Political Majors, or
YPM. The voters said YPM tricked them by saying they were signing a
petition to toughen penalties against child molesters. The firm was
paid $7 to $12 for every Californian it registered as a member of the
GOP.

Several agencies had launched investigations into Jacoby's activities,
including the Los Angeles County district attorney's office, which
issued the warrant for his arrest earlier this month on felony charges
of voter registration fraud and perjury.

Efforts to reach Jacoby were unsuccessful.
